About Māndalgarh

Māndalgarh is a town located in India, in the Rajasthan region. With a recorded population of 21,569, it is home to a diverse community of residents.

Geographically, Māndalgarh lies at coordinates 25.19°N, 75.07°E, placing it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. The city operates on the Asia/Kolkata tim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
